    Don Warrington is a British actor who is best known for his role in the ITV sitcom Rising Damp.

    In 2008, he was appointed to the Order of the British Empire (MBE). His precisely enunciated upper-class accent has become a trademark of his acting.

    Don Warrington Age Explored

    Don Warrington is 70 years old.

    Donald Williams, born on May 23, 1951, in Trinidad to Basil Kydd and Shirley Williams, emigrated to England with his mother and brother when he was five years old. His sister, on the other hand, remained in his home country. His father, a politician who died in 1958, was a philanthropist.

    Don grew up in Newcastle and attended Harris College after his relocation (University of Central Lancashire). He also studied at the Drama Center London. After meeting another actor with the same name while auditioning for Equity, he chose the stage name Don Warrington, named after the street he grew up on.

    He began acting in repertory theatre at the age of 17.
